What Is HL7?
HL7 stands for Health Level Seven, which refers to the seventh layer of the OSI (Open Systems Interconnection) model—the application layer where healthcare applications communicate with each other.
HL7 is not a software tool or programming language. Instead, it is a set of standards that define how healthcare information should be structured and exchanged between systems.
For example, when a patient is admitted to a hospital, multiple systems may need to receive that information, including:
- Electronic Health Record (EHR) systems
- Laboratory information systems
- Billing and insurance systems
- Pharmacy management systems
- Radiology systems
HL7 ensures that these systems can exchange information efficiently, even if they are developed by different vendors.

Key Components Covered in HL7 Training
A good HL7 training program usually introduces several important concepts that form the foundation of healthcare data exchange.
1. HL7 Message Structure
HL7 messages follow a structured format that allows systems to interpret patient data correctly. Messages are divided into segments, and each segment contains multiple fields separated by special characters called delimiters.
Common segments include:
- MSH (Message Header) – contains information about the sender, receiver, and message type
- PID (Patient Identification) – contains patient demographic information
- PV1 (Patient Visit) – contains visit-related information
- OBR (Observation Request) – contains lab test orders
- OBX (Observation Result) – contains clinical results
Understanding message structure is one of the first skills taught in HL7 training.
2. HL7 Message Types
HL7 messages are generated when certain events occur in a healthcare system. These are known as trigger events.
Common HL7 message types include:
- ADT (Admission, Discharge, Transfer) – patient movement within the hospital
- ORM (Order Message) – used when a physician orders lab tests or procedures
- ORU (Observation Result) – used to send laboratory or diagnostic results
HL7 training teaches learners how these messages are triggered and how they move between systems.

3. Healthcare System Integration
One of the main goals of HL7 is system interoperability. Hospitals often use multiple software systems that must work together seamlessly.
HL7 training explains how different healthcare systems connect and exchange data using interfaces.
For example:
- A patient is admitted into the hospital system.
- An ADT message is generated.
- The message is sent to the laboratory, billing, and pharmacy systems.
- Each system updates its records with the patient information.
This process ensures accurate and synchronized patient data across the entire hospital environment.
Why Is HL7 Used in Healthcare?
HL7 plays a critical role in healthcare because it enables systems to share patient information efficiently and securely.
Below are some of the main reasons HL7 is widely used in healthcare environments.
1. Interoperability Between Systems
Healthcare organizations often use systems from different vendors. Without a common standard, these systems would struggle to communicate.
HL7 provides a standardized format that allows different systems to exchange data reliably.
This interoperability is essential for modern healthcare operations.
2. Improved Patient Care
Accurate and timely information is critical for patient care. HL7 ensures that patient data is available to the right system at the right time.
For example:
- Doctors can access lab results quickly
- Pharmacists can verify medication orders
- Billing departments receive correct patient information
This helps healthcare providers make faster and better decisions.
3. Efficient Workflow in Hospitals
Hospitals handle thousands of patient interactions daily. HL7 helps automate many of these workflows.
For example:
- When a patient is admitted, information automatically reaches all relevant systems.
- When lab results are ready, they are automatically sent to the physician’s system.
This reduces manual work and improves operational efficiency.
4. Standardized Data Exchange
Without standards, each healthcare system would use its own format for data exchange. This would create confusion and errors.
HL7 ensures that data is structured in a consistent format that systems can interpret correctly.
Real-World Uses of HL7
HL7 is used in a wide range of healthcare scenarios. Some common real-world applications include:
Hospital Information Systems
Hospitals rely on HL7 to coordinate patient data across departments such as registration, billing, laboratory, and radiology.
Laboratory Systems
When a physician orders a test, an ORM message is sent to the lab system. After the test is completed, an ORU message returns the results to the hospital system.
Radiology Systems
Imaging results such as X-rays or MRIs can be transmitted using HL7 messages to ensure physicians receive diagnostic data quickly.
Pharmacy Systems
Medication orders and prescription details can be shared between hospital systems and pharmacy management systems.
